At the recent Social Science Community for the GBR’s symposium “REEFLECTIONS” in Townsville, the workshop was presented by The Cairns Institute’s D/Prof Stewart Lockie, Dr Rana Dadpour, Dr Gillian Paxton, and First Nations TCI Cadet Charlie Milson-Owen. It unpacked findings from the RRAP Social Licence project — a major study of community, stakeholder, and Traditional Owner perspectives on reef restoration and adaptation.
Participants explored how social insights can inform policy, guide management, and strengthen the Reef’s resilience to climate change. Together, they mapped opportunities, identified indicators, and co-produced recommendations for embedding social licence into future reef initiatives. ??
